Removal and InstallationINFOID:0000000001542681
FRONT DOOR
Removal
CAUTION:
• When removing and instal ling the door assembly, support the door with a jack and shop cloth to pro-
tect the door and body.
• When removing and installing door assembly, be sure to carry out the fitting adjustment.
• Check the hinge rotating part for poor lubrication. If necessary, apply "body grease".
1. Remove the door window and module assembly. Refer to GW-9, "
Removal and Installation".
2. Remove the door harness.
3. Remove the check link cover.
4. Remove the check link bolt from the hinge pillar.
5. Remove the door-side hinge nuts and bolts, and remove the door assembly.
Installation
Installation is in the reverse order of removal.

BACK DOOR
Removal
WARNING:
Always support back door when re moving or replacing back door stays. Power back door opener will
not support back door with back door stays removed.
1. Remove the back door glass. Refer to GW-7, "
Removal and Installation".
2. Remove the back door lock assembly. Refer to DLK-237, "
Door Lock Assembly".
3. Remove the rear wiper motor. Refer to WW-83, "
Rear Wiper Motor".
4. Remove the back door wire harness.
5. Remove the rear washer nozzle and hose from the back door. Refer to WW-85, "
Rear Washer Tube Lay-
out".
CAUTION:
Two technicians should be used to avo id damaging the back door during removal.
6. Support the back door.
7. Disconnect the power back door lift arm from the door.
8. Remove the back door stays.
9. Remove the door side nuts and the back door assembly.
